What Are Dermal Fillers? Dermal fillers are injectable gel-like substances used to restore lost volume, smooth wrinkles, and enhance facial contours. They are commonly made from hyaluronic acid (HA), calcium hydroxylapatite (CaHA), or collagen stimulators, which help maintain a youthful and natural appearance.
Dermal fillers are widely used to treat: ? Nasolabial folds (smile lines) ? Lip enhancement ? Cheek and chin augmentation ? Under-eye hollows ? Jawline contouring ? Hand rejuvenation
Types of Dermal Fillers There are various types of dermal fillers, each with unique properties tailored for different cosmetic needs.
1. Hyaluronic Acid (HA) Fillers The most popular type of dermal filler. HA is a naturally occurring substance in the skin that retains moisture and adds volume. Provides instant results that last 6 to 18 months. Best for: Lips, cheeks, under-eye hollows, and fine lines. Popular brands: Juvederm, Restylane, Revolax, Neuramis, Dermalax. 2. Calcium Hydroxylapatite (CaHA) Fillers Composed of calcium-based microspheres suspended in a gel. Stimulates collagen production for long-lasting volume restoration. Lasts 12 to 24 months. Best for: Deep wrinkles, jawline contouring, and hand rejuvenation. Popular brand: Radiesse. 3. Poly-L-Lactic Acid (PLLA) Fillers A collagen stimulator that works gradually to restore skin structure. Effects appear over time and last up to 2 years. Best for: Severe volume loss, deep wrinkles, and facial rejuvenation. Popular brand: Sculptra. 4. Polymethyl Methacrylate (PMMA) Fillers A semi-permanent filler with microspheres and collagen. Provides long-term volume and wrinkle correction. Best for: Deep-set wrinkles, acne scars, and facial contouring. Popular brand: Bellafill. 5. Fat Grafting (Autologous Fat Transfer) Uses your own fat cells extracted from areas like the abdomen or thighs. Offers natural and long-lasting results. Best for: Cheek augmentation, deep wrinkles, and hand rejuvenation. Benefits of Dermal Fillers Dermal fillers have gained popularity for their immediate and long-term advantages.

Possible Risks and Side Effects While dermal fillers are generally safe, improper injections can lead to complications. Potential side effects include:
? Swelling, redness, or bruising – Common after treatment, usually resolving within days. ? Lumps or uneven texture – Can occur if the filler is not properly distributed. ? Allergic reactions – Rare, but possible in sensitive individuals. ? Filler migration – When the filler moves from the injected area. ? Infection or vascular occlusion – A serious but rare risk requiring immediate medical attention.
To minimize risks, always choose a licensed and experienced professional for your filler treatments.
Choosing the Right Dermal Filler for You 1. Identify Your Aesthetic Goals For plumper lips ? Hyaluronic Acid Fillers (Juvederm, Restylane) For deep wrinkle correction ? CaHA or PLLA Fillers (Radiesse, Sculptra) For cheek and jawline enhancement ? CaHA or PMMA Fillers For long-lasting results ? PLLA or PMMA Fillers 2. Consider Longevity If you prefer a temporary effect, choose HA fillers (6-12 months). For longer-lasting results, collagen stimulators like Sculptra or Radiesse last 1-2 years.
3. Check for Reversibility Hyaluronic Acid Fillers can be dissolved with hyaluronidase, making them a safer choice for first-time users. Other fillers like PLLA and PMMA are not reversible.
4. Consult a Professional A board-certified injector will assess your skin type, facial structure, and desired results to recommend the best filler for you.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) 1. Are dermal fillers painful? Most fillers contain lidocaine, a numbing agent that reduces discomfort. The procedure is quick, and most people feel only mild pressure.
2. How long do dermal fillers last? HA fillers last 6-18 months, while CaHA and PLLA fillers can last 1-2 years.
3. Can dermal fillers be removed? Yes, hyaluronic acid fillers can be dissolved using hyaluronidase. Other types of fillers are not reversible.
4. At what age should I get dermal fillers? There’s no specific age requirement, but most people start fillers in their late 20s to early 30s for prevention or in their 40s-50s for restoration.
5. Can I combine fillers with Botox? Yes! Fillers restore volume, while Botox relaxes wrinkles. Many patients get both treatments together for a balanced, youthful look.
